Cardston, Alberta — January 7, 2026 — Leads & Copy — Stinger Resources Inc. is planning a non-brokered private placement of up to $160,000, the company announced today.
The offering will consist of up to 3,200,000 units sold to eligible purchasers at $0.05 per unit. Each unit includes one common share of the company and one common share purchase warrant.
Each warrant allows the holder to purchase one common share of Stinger Resources at $0.06 any time up to 24 months after the offering’s closing date.
The units are being offered to qualified purchasers under exemptions from prospectus and registration requirements of applicable securities legislation. Proceeds from the unit sales will be used for general working capital.
All securities issued and sold under the offering will be subject to a hold period expiring four months and one day from their issuance date, following CSE policies and applicable securities laws.
Company insiders are expected to participate in the offering. Any insider participation may be a related party transaction under Multilateral Instrument 61-101. Exemptions from formal valuation and minority shareholder approval requirements may apply because the company is not listed on specified exchanges or markets, and the securities distributed to insiders will not exceed 25% of the company’s market capitalization.
Stinger Resources holds interests in gold and silver properties in British Columbia, including the Dunwell Mine near Stewart, and the Gold Hill property near Fort Steele. The company also owns 100% of the Silver Side property and has an optioned interest in the Ample Goldmax property, both also in British Columbia.
